Effective Self-Storage Management Tips


Operating a storage facility requires attention and strategic planning. Here are some tips to help owners improve your business's performance.



1: Implement Modern Security Measures


Safety is vital in self-storage management. Set up high-quality surveillance systems and use entry systems. Ensure that all system is operating efficiently at constantly. Think about installing motion detectors for extra security.



Next: Ensure Well-Maintained Facilities


Frequent upkeep is necessary for operational efficiency. Organize maintenance activities to keep your business clean and organized. Create a detailed maintenance plan and instruct employees on correct procedures. Regularly inspect the facilities to spot and resolve problems quickly.



Additionally: Enhance Client Relations


Excellent customer interaction will differentiate your business. Train team members to act friendly and handle client issues promptly. Adopt surveys to receive insights from customers and use this input to enhance offerings. Provide incentives for referrals to build a loyal customer base.



Fourth: Utilize Effective Marketing Techniques


Advertising your self-storage business effectively should attract additional business. Leverage digital advertising to target potential customers. Develop a user-friendly online presence that provides easy access to units. Communicate with customers through regular updates and offer promotions to encourage rentals.



Lastly: Emphasize Continuous Improvement


Continuous development for team members is vital to ensure high standards. Organize training sessions on up-to-date management techniques. Support staff to bring new ideas and acknowledge excellent performance. Create a productive work environment that prioritizes continuous improvement.
